Company Description

Caterlink is the education sector catering specialist. For over 20 years, the company has delivered fresh food solutions to pupils and staff at Primary Schools, Secondary Schools, and Colleges across the UK. The company caters more than 1,000,000 meals a week. Our “Fresh Food Policy” is the foundation of our success and growth in the market, coupled with a desire to truly deliver on the promises we make to our clients and support our site-based teams.

Job Description

We are looking to fill a position for a Catering Assistant at Willow Park Primary School, Oldham, OL1 4LJ. Duties will include a variety of food production tasks. This role is term-time only and no weekends, so it is great for those looking for flexibility.

The Role

  • £12.71 per hour
  • Monday – Friday: 23.5 hours a week
  • Term-time only – working 38 weeks per year

Your Key Responsibilities Will Include

  • Assisting in the preparation of tasty food and snacks
  • Complying with Caterlink Health and Safety and Food Safety standards and procedures
  • Keeping the kitchen, counter, and restaurant areas in a clean and tidy state
  • Providing a friendly, efficient, and hygienic service to all customers
  • Representing Caterlink and maintaining a positive brand image
